Output ccb2608218daffe0c5d11fc71a73e2fb45ba40486073cda86c03e2a2e315384f:0

value
607616799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7f2e0de2d49d95190c4a32679d3d7c36808b3e2 OP_EQUAL
address
3MNrAGpwdneWDn8ohg9sk81ytF7CDNGMfY
transaction
ccb2608218daffe0c5d11fc71a73e2fb45ba40486073cda86c03e2a2e315384f
confirmations
501263
spent
true